FLIR Delivers Thermal Imaging Camera-Equipped Drones to Korea South-East Power

Google 우선 소스Published2019.10.03 12:55
FLIR Duo™ Pro R, 640 x 512 resolution thermal imaging sensor, integrated 4K color video camera
A scale of 165,000 , equivalent to the area of 23 soccer fields, can be inspected within one hour.

FLIR Systems Korea announced that Korea South-East Power has improved inspection efficiency for its solar power facilities by utilizing drone equipment equipped with FLIR Duo Pro R thermal imaging camera modules, and is considering introducing drone-type thermal imaging camera equipment to additional solar power facilities scheduled for establishment.

Korea South-East Power recently introduced an XDRONE XD-i4 model drone equipped with a FLIR Duo Pro R thermal imaging camera for aerial monitoring of the solar power generation facility at the No. 1 Wastewater Treatment Plant of its Samcheonpo Power Plant.

Completed in April 2017, this power plant is the first large-capacity solar power plant in Korea to utilize idle land at a coal ash landfill. It has a generating capacity of 10 MWp and a facility area of 165,000 , which is equivalent to the combined area of approximately 23 soccer fields. Based on the judgment that a combination of drones and thermal imaging cameras would be an effective solution for monitoring such large-scale solar power facilities, Korea South-East Power introduced the XD-i4 model drone from domestic manufacturer XDRONE and FLIR's Duo™ Pro R640 thermal imaging camera module.

Ma Sang-hee, a representative from Korea South-East Power, stated, “Due to the nature of a public enterprise, we prioritized purchasing products from domestic small and medium-sized enterprises for the drones themselves, but for the thermal imaging camera, which is a core piece of equipment for monitoring inspections, we selected FLIR products after comprehensively considering functionality, performance, and brand reliability.” She added, “We evaluated the FLIR Duo Pro R as the optimal solution for operation on drones because it not only integrates thermal and visible light sensors into a single unit in a compact size but also supports standard protocols that allow for easy operation on drones, as well as storage devices and analysis programs.”
